An exciting opportunity exists for an experienced case manager to work with the H2H Team. This is a fixed term position of twelve months.

Join a team that has been providing assertive outreach case management support to people who have experienced long term significant homelessness and who are now housed with the goal to assist with sustaining their tenancies.

Be part of an opportunity to facilitate stability in the lives of people who have experienced considerable disadvantage.

This role will suit candidates who have experience supporting clients with complex needs, possess Counselling skills
or are competent in Duel Diagnosis.

A current Victorian Drivers Licence is essential.

Ideally, you will possess:

  • A professional qualification in either Social Work, Psychology, Counselling, Community Services
  • Experience in Case Management in the Homelessness, Mental Health and/or AOD sectors
  • Demonstrated ability to provide client centred, trauma informed practice. Build rapport with complex client cohort
  • Excellent knowledge of Homelessness, Mental Health Support Systems and Social Housing.
  • A clear understanding of Sustaining Tenancies framework, barriers to sustaining tenancies for H2H clients
